Intermediate & Advanced Cross-Asset Excel API
8:00 – 8:50 AM

Bloomberg’s API Advanced Specialist, Michael Steele, will demonstrate leveraging the Excel API Add-In with various multi-asset use cases.  Specifically, we will discuss pulling commodity futures and options pricing into Excel (price, volume, open interest), as well as real-time and historical cross-currency rates, EQS (equity screening) searches, Best Estimates and bond pricing. 

Technicals & Charting
9:00 – 9:50 AM
Bloomberg’s Technical Analysis and Charting Specialist, Tom Schneider, leads a discussion on analyzing Trading Ideas on Bloomberg. Bloomberg's advanced technical tools such as BT (Back Testing), STDY (Custom Study) and TSIG (Trading Signals) allow us to visualize, analyze and optimize ideas around the market within the Bloomberg terminal. We can also schedule screens on our universe (portfolio, watchlist, equity screen results) to monitor for these ideas.  In closing, we will have a general review of creating charts on Bloomberg, adding events and content to your charts and managing your charts library.

Hedging Commodity Currencies
1:10 – 2:00 PM
Bloomberg’s Foreign Exchange and Economics Market Specialist, Alison Fletcher, reviews the challenges and opportunities of hedging commodity currencies.  Learn how to determine FX direction using economic indicators, market sentiment, forecasts, regulatory reporting to see market depth, examining portfolio/trade flows and looking for potential correlation with commodities.  Optimize your FX hedge using Bloomberg’s back-testing and hedge effectiveness solutions.

Risk Management:  MARS, Multi-Asset Risk Solution
3:10 – 4:00 PM

Bloomberg’s Rates and Fixed Income Market Specialist, Yon Valtchev, will discuss how to monitor and manage market risk, quantify credit and counterparty risk, hedge specific risk exposures and evaluate portfolio risk on an individual or aggregated basis using our Multi-Asset Risk System (MARS).  MARS helps you monitor, assess, and manage risk in today's complex and interconnected markets. MARS calculators and portfolio tools are fueled by market-leading models and tools that help risk managers fully understand risk exposure, from single trades to the contents of an entire multi-asset portfolio.

Cameron Friesen, Minister of Finance

Member of Legislative Assembly of Manitoba: 2011 - Present.

Minister of Finance: 2016 - Present.

Born and raised in Morden, Manitoba, Cameron received degrees from the Canadian Mennonite University and the University of British Columbia. Cameron later earned his education degree at the University of Manitoba and taught for 12 years in the public school system. He subsequently served as Executive Assistant for the local Member of Parliament for Portage-Lisgar. Cameron was first elected to the Legislative Assembly of Manitoba in the 2011 provincial election, in the constituency of Morden-Winkler.  Prior to the 2016 election, Cameron was a member of the Public Accounts Committee and served as critic for Education, Health and Finance. Currently, under Premier Brian Pallister, Cameron serves as Minister of Finance, Minister responsible for the Civil Service, and Chair of the Treasury Board. He is a member of the government's Planning and Priorities Cabinet Committee and is the first acting for the Minister of Growth, Enterprise & Trade.
